if $overline{pq}$ and $overline{rs}$ are coplanar and do not intersect, which of the following statements are true?
check all that apply.
□ $overline{pq}$ and $overline{rs}$ are parallel
□ $overline{pq}$ and $overline{rs}$ intersect at a single point
□ $overline{pq}paralleloverline{rs}$
□ $overline{pq}$ and $overline{rs}$ do not intersect
□ $overline{pq}perpoverline{rs}$
□ $overline{pq}$ and $overline{rs}$ are coplanar

Explanation:

Step1: Recall parallel - line definition

In a plane, non - intersecting lines are parallel.

Step2: Analyze each statement

Given that $\overline{PQ}$ and $\overline{RS}$ are coplanar and do not intersect:

  • “$\overline{PQ}$ and $\overline{RS}$ are parallel”: By the definition of parallel lines in a plane (coplanar and non - intersecting), this is true.
  • “$\overline{PQ}$ and $\overline{RS}$ intersect at a single point”: Given they do not intersect, this is false.
  • “$\overline{PQ}\parallel\overline{RS}$”: This is just another way of saying they are parallel, so it is true.
  • “$\overline{PQ}$ and $\overline{RS}$ do not intersect”: Given in the problem statement, this is true.
  • “$\overline{PQ}\perp\overline{RS}$”: Perpendicular lines intersect at a right - angle, but they do not intersect, so this is false.
  • “$\overline{PQ}$ and $\overline{RS}$ are coplanar”: Given in the problem statement, this is true.

Answer:

$\overline{PQ}$ and $\overline{RS}$ are parallel, $\overline{PQ}\parallel\overline{RS}$, $\overline{PQ}$ and $\overline{RS}$ do not intersect, $\overline{PQ}$ and $\overline{RS}$ are coplanar.
